English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

安装 Elasticsearch

Dans ce chapitre, nous allons examiner en détail le processus d'installation d'Elasticsearch.

Pour installer Elasticsearch sur votre ordinateur local, vous devrez suivre les étapes suivantes-

Étape 1−Vérifiez la version de Java installée sur l'ordinateur. Elle devrait être Java 7ou une version plus récente. Vous pouvez vérifier en effectuant les opérations suivantes-

dans le système d'exploitation Windows (en utilisant leinvite de commande)-

> java -version

Dans UNIX OS (utilisez le terminal)-

$ echo $JAVA_HOME

Étape 2 −Téléchargez Elasticsearch selon votre système d'exploitation à partir de www.elastic.co −

  • Pour Windows OS, téléchargez le fichier ZIP.

  • Pour UNIX OS, téléchargez le fichier TAR.

  • Pour Debian OS, téléchargez le fichier DEB.

  • Pour Red Hat et d'autres distributions Linux, téléchargez le fichier RPN.

  • Les utilitaires APT et YUM peuvent également être utilisés pour installer Elasticsearch sur de nombreux distributions Linux.

Étape 3 −Le processus d'installation d'Elasticsearch est simple, voici une introduction aux différentes plateformes d'exploitation −

  • Windows OS−Décompressez le fichier zip, puis installez Elasticsearch.

  • UNIX OS−Décompressez le fichier tar dans n'importe quel emplacement, puis installez Elasticsearch.

$wget
https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ch7.0.0-linux-x86_64.tar.gz
$tar -xzf elasticsearch-7.0.0-linux-x86_64.tar.gz
  • Utilisez l'utilitaire APT sur le système d'exploitation Linux−Téléchargez et installez la clé de signature publique

$ wget -qo - https://artifacts.elastic.co/GPG-KEY-elasticsearch | sudo
apt-key add -

Enregistrez la définition du dépôt comme suit :

$ echo "deb https://artifacts.elastic.co/packages/7.x/apt stable main" |
sudo tee -a /etc/apt/sources.list.d/elastic-7.x.list

Exécutez la mise à jour en utilisant la commande suivante-

$ sudo apt-get update

Vous pouvez maintenant installer Elasticsearch en utilisant la commande suivante-

$ sudo apt-get install elasticsearch
  • Téléchargez et installez manuellement le paquet Debian en utilisant la commande suivante

$w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ch7.0.0-amd64.deb
$sudo dpkg -i elasticsearch-7.0.0-amd64.deb0
  • Utilisez l'utilitaire YUM sur le système d'exploitation Debian Linux

  • Téléchargez et installez la clé de signature publique-

$ rpm --import https://artifacts.elastic.co/GPG-KEY-elasticsearch
  • Ajoutez le texte suivant à votre « /etc/yum.repos.d/le fichier avec l'extension .repo dans le répertoire «

elasticsearch-7.x]
name=Elasticsearch repository for 7.x packages
baseurl=https://artifacts.elastic.co/packages/7.x/yum
gpgcheck=1
gpgkey=https://artifacts.elastic.co/GPG-KEY-elasticsearch
enabled=1
autorefresh=1
type=rpm-md
  • Vous pouvez maintenant installer Elasticsearch en utilisant la commande suivante

sudo yum install elasticsearch

Étape 4− Allez dans le répertoire principal d'Elasticsearch et situés dans le dossier bin. Si vous utilisez Windows, exécutez le fichier elasticsearch.bat ; si vous utilisez UNIX, exécutez le fichier elasticsearch en utilisant le prompt des commandes ou en exécutant la même opération via le terminal.

Dans Windows

> cd elasticsearch-2.1.0/bin
> elasticsearch

Dans Linux

$ cd elasticsearch-2.1.0/bin
$ ./elasticsearch

Remarque − Si vous utilisez Windows, vous pourriez recevoir un message d'erreur indiquant que JAVA_HOME n'est pas défini, veuillez le définir dans les variables d'environnement à "C:\ Program Files \ Java \ jre1.8.0_31"ou l'emplacement de l'installation de Java.

Étape 5− Le port par défaut de l'interface Web d'Elasticsearch est9200, ou vous pouvez le modifier en changeant le fichier elasticsearch.yml existant dans le répertoire bin. Vous pouvez vérifier si le serveur est démarré et en cours d'exécution en naviguanthttp://localhost:9200Il renverra un objet JSON sous la forme suivante, contenant des informations sur l'Elasticsearch installé-

{
   "name" : "Brain-Child
   "cluster_name" : "elasticsearch", "version" : {
      "number" : ""2.1.0",
      "build_hash" : ""72cd1f1a3eee09505e036106146dc1949dc5dc87",
      "build_timestamp" : ""2015-11-18T22:40:03Z",
      "build_snapshot" : false,
      "lucene_version" : ""5.3.1"
   ,
   "tagline" : "You Know, for Search"
}

Étape 6− Dans cette étape, installons Kibana. Suivez le code fourni ci-dessous pour l'installation sur Linux et Windows-

conçu pour l'installation sur Linux

wget https://artifacts.elastic.co/downloads/kibana/kibana-7.0.0-linuxx86_64.tar.gz
tar -xzf kibana-7.0.0-linux-x86_64.tar.gz
cd kibana-7.0.0-linux-x86_64/
./bin/kibana

用于在Windows上安装-

https://www.elastic.co/products/kibana下载Windows版Kibana 单击链接后,您将找到如下所示的主页-

解压缩并转到Kibana主目录,然后运行它。

CD c:\kibana-7.0.0-windows-x86_64
.\bin\kibana.bat